If so what you are saying is correct the holes in the baskets are NOT where the water exits the canister they are where the water enters. The canister works like this ... the water enters the canister and goes down through the hole in the baskets (and past the UV if one is fitted) to the bottom then rises up through the media baskets to the top where it is captured by the impeller and exits the canister back to the tank.
